What the form asks for
- Part A - B.A.H. (Applies to CONUS and Overseas Locations.) 1. Name (last, first, middle initial).
- 2. Retired grade.
- 3. Social security number. Do not include dashes.
- 4. Branch of service retired from. Press space bar to mark X in first box if Army, second box if Air Force, third box if Navy, fourth box if Marines, or fifth box if Coast Guard.
- 5. Current address of instructor. a. Street (include apartment or suite number).
- 5.b. City.
- 5.c. State.
- 5.d. Zip Code.
- 5.e. Daytime telephone number (include area code).
- 6. Employing School Information. a. Name and address of school (include zip code).
- 6.a.(1) Telephone number. Include area code.
- 6.a.(2) Fax number. Include area code.
- 6.b. Name and address of school district (include Zip Code).
- 6.b.(1) Telephone number. Include area code.
- 6.b.(2) Fax number. Include area code.
- 6.c. School (unit) identification.
- 7. Marital status. X first box if married, second box if single, third box if divorced, fourth box if separated.
- 8. Status of spouse. X first box if non-military, second box if other federal service, third box if active duty member, fourth box if JROTC instructor.
- 9. If spouse is active duty or instructor. a. Social security number.
- 9.b. Branch of service.
- 9.c. Duty location.
- 10.a. Residing in government/employer provided quarters? X first box if yes, second box if no.
- b. If yes, do either you or your spouse pay rent? X first box if yes, second box if no.
- 11. If not married, do you have dependents? X first box if yes, second box if no.
